How they compare
China currently reports 19.1% against 18.8% in Libya,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Libya ahead.
China ranks 39th and Libya ranks 42nd of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, China averaged higher in 5 and Libya in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| China | Libya |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.1% | 0.1% | 0.0% | Libya |
| 1970s | 4.5% | 0.1% | 4.4% | China |
| 1980s | 16.2% | 0.7% | 15.4% | China |
| 1990s | 25.9% | 2.0% | 23.9% | China |
| 2000s | 22.2% | 6.9% | 15.3% | China |
| 2010s | 19.1% | 18.8% | 0.4% | China |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
